| Description | Grant file containing correspondence, agendas, file sheet, reports, file notes, financial papers, constitution, general information and due diligence form and project proposal relating to the Muslim Youth Helpline (MYH), London. Funding source(s): Barrow Cadbury Trust. Applicant overview: MYH was founded in 2001 as a youth initiative to respond to the social problems affecting young Muslims. The absence of effective community support schemes and the apathy amongst the wider community in dealing with rising levels of social exclusion, mental health problems, abuse and criminal activity led to the creation of an anonymous helpline service putting young people at the frontline of service provision. MYH provides faith and culturally sensitive support services to young Muslims 16 to 25 years of age. Nature of support: In 2008 the Trust agreed to a grant of £30,000 to the MYH for an outreach and advocacy project based on the dissemination of the Reelhood series of films. Minutes: T08/09-34.
